Output ef6f6d33e310aa1875210f8b504eb357637cd1467b38e5a378b56f76429c1af9:3

value
22630703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c420a1a7ce3001ff9ff10d8b2921361f54c43c OP_EQUAL
address
33QF3Avp9v6h2yMzopEQc3oytdVMusvxf9
transaction
ef6f6d33e310aa1875210f8b504eb357637cd1467b38e5a378b56f76429c1af9
spent
true